CLEMSON — Clemson trailed SMU, 16-7, at halftime of Saturday’s game — SMU’s first visit to Memorial Stadium, and a rematch of the classic 2024 ACC Championship Game in Charlotte.
SMU took a 10-0 lead thanks to a 70-yard touchdown pass from quarterback Kevin Jennings to wide receiver Jordan Hudson in the first quarter, and then a 51-yard Sam Keltner field goal in the second period.
The Tigers got on the board midway through the second quarter with a 32-yard touchdown pass from quarterback Christopher Vizzina to wide receiver T.J. Moore, before SMU responded with a 48-yard field goal from Keltner.
SMU then added another field goal from Keltner, once again from 48 yards, to take a 16-7 lead into the locker room.
